Review Job Details

Ensure job postings focus on skills and responsibilities (PDF) , rather than qualifications and requirements, to remove unnecessary barriers to entry and to help job seekers better understand the role.

  • Highlight “responsibilities” instead of “requirements” on job postings by detailing the tasks candidates will encounter on the job or the results they’re expected to achieve.
  • Emphasize training and development opportunities to attract candidates with transferrable skills, or those who lack experience but have potential.

Facts:

  • Job postings that list responsibilities instead of requirements get 14% more applicants per view than those that only list formal requirements
